PhoneGap中文网

标题: Jqmobi的scroller插件实现上下拉动效果很卡 [打印本页]

作者: topcnm    时间: 2014-12-7 21:03
标题: Jqmobi的scroller插件实现上下拉动效果很卡
我用scroller插件实现下拉刷新新闻列表,当加载条数到达30跳左右的时候,手机app开始跳帧卡顿,请问一般会是什么问题。
代码直接照着树根老师的方法写的额。

2014-12-07_210111.png (117.11 KB, 下载次数: 292)

2014-12-07_210111.png

作者: topcnm    时间: 2014-12-7 21:06
版本号:2.1
代码:
$(function(){
    var myScroller_video;
    $.ui.ready(function () {
        myScroller_video = $("#doc_videoList").scroller();
        myScroller_video.addInfinite();
        myScroller_video.addPullToRefresh();
        myScroller_video.runCB=true;

        var hideClose;
        $.bind(myScroller_video, "refresh-release", function () {
            var that = this;
            clearTimeout(hideClose);
            hideClose = setTimeout(function () {
                that.hideRefresh();
            }, 1200);
            return false;
        });

        myScroller_video.enable();
        $.bind(myScroller_video, "infinite-scroll", function () {
            var self = this;
            $(this.el).append("<div id='infinite' style='width:100%;height:3rem;line-height:3rem;text-align: center'>上拉刷新</div>");
            $.bind(myScroller_video, "infinite-scroll-end", function () {
                $.unbind(myScroller_video, "infinite-scroll-end");
                $("#infinite").text("正在加载...")
//                    self.scrollToBottom();//加载完成后自动滑到最底部
                var innerHTML_search = "";
                var sample_search_array = data_video.data.list;
                for(var i = 0;i<sample_search_array.length;i++){
                    innerHTML_search += structureHTML4Video(
                        sample_search_array[i].id,
                        sample_search_array[i].image,
                        sample_search_array[i].title,
                        sample_search_array[i].descript,
                        sample_search_array[i].publish,
                        sample_search_array[i].time
                    )
                }
                setTimeout(function(){
                    $("#doc_videoList_container").append(innerHTML_search);
                    $(self.el).find("#infinite").remove();
                    self.clearInfinite();
                },2000)

//                    self.scrollToBottom();
            });
        });
    });

})
作者: admin    时间: 2014-12-8 20:35
app 可以放出来测试一下吗 或者放在网站上  不知道你的机器是什么机器测试的,还有就是检查一下你的 图片的大小
作者: university    时间: 2015-4-29 14:49
非常好 感谢 开始学习html5 app开发了
作者: luckyjianxin    时间: 2015-4-29 22:56
很不错,不错,学习学习。跨平台得顶起
作者: xiaota    时间: 2015-4-30 02:42
html5 是趋势
作者: luckyjianxin    时间: 2015-4-30 03:13
未来属于html5 phonegap 微信 wap全部搞定
作者: 缺德    时间: 2015-4-30 11:33

作者: 章先生    时间: 2015-5-6 12:33
我也碰到了这样的问题,求解决啊




欢迎光临 PhoneGap中文网 (http://bbs.phonegap100.com/) Powered by Discuz! X3.2